**Polymyalgia rheumatica** is an inflammatory disease that is mostly seen in the elderly. This condition usually leads to pain and stiffness in the shoulder and upper back or hip area. Polymyalgia rheumatica (PMR) leads to widespread pain, stiffness and flu-like symptoms.. This disease is usually seen in people around 70 years old and rarely affects people under 50 years old.. Sometimes this disease remains between one and five years in people.. but the duration of this disease varies from person to person. Usually 15% of people with PMR develop a serious condition called temporal arthritis. The cause of polymyalgia rheumatica The cause of PMR disease is not known.. but doctors think that autoimmunity plays an important role in causing such a problem. Autoimmunity means the attack of the body's immune system on healthy tissues... Genetic and environmental factors such as infections play a very important role. Since the possibility of this disease occurring in people under 50 is very rare, the cause of its occurrence can also be related to the aging process. What are the symptoms of polymyalgia rheumatica? Symptoms of PMR are caused by inflammation of the joint and its surrounding tissues and usually start slowly or suddenly. Usually, the feeling of stiffness in the morning and prolonged immobility lead to worsening of the patient's condition. The feeling of pain and stiffness causes the non-use of some parts of the body, which ultimately leads to muscle weakness.. Most people with polymyalgia rheumatica feel pain and stiffness in the following two areas: - lesson - Neck - Ran - upper arm and shoulder Other symptoms of PMR include: - Low appetite - weight loss - fatigue - Fever Sometimes polymyalgia rheumatica occurs together with another serious disease called temporal arthritis, which creates dangerous conditions for a person. New and persistent headaches, especially on the side of the head, skin sensitivity, vision changes or jaw pain when eating can be serious symptoms of this disease. How to diagnose polymyalgia rheumatica When you see a pain specialist, he will ask you about your symptoms and medical history...he will also do a physical exam. Blood tests are done to check the level of inflammation and rule out possible con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is and lupus that lead to PMR symptoms. How is polymyalgia rheumatica treated? The goal of treatment is to reduce pain, inflammation, stiffness, pain, fatigue, and finally improve fever. Usually, treatment methods include anti-inflammatory drugs and exercise. Corticosteroids are strong anti-inflammatory drugs that reduce inflammation, stiffness, and pain.... After symptoms improve, the dose of the prescribed medication is reduced.... Sometimes, the mild type of PMR is prescribed by a pain specialist with non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s to reduce symptoms.. Exercise and adequate rest both play a very important role in the treatment of polymyalgia rheumatica. The importance of doing sports can be mentioned to maintain flexibility of joints, muscle strength and essential functions of the body. Cycling, walking and exercising in the pool are some of the recommended exercises for exercise despite having this disease. Also, you should have enough rest after exercise so that you can perform your exercises sufficiently and with energy in other cases. Care tips for people with polymyalgia rheumatica If you've had treatment, the symptoms will lessen or go away completely within a few days... Without treatment, it usually goes away on its own after a year. But sometimes it takes up to five years, the duration of this disease is different for each person. To control this disease, you should have these items in your daily schedule: - proper nutrition - sports activity - Timely and complete use of prescribed drugs - Adequate rest When the feeling of stiffness in the body is removed, you can go about your daily activities, including exercise. Familiarity with temporal arthritis As we mentioned throughout the article, sometimes some people with polymyalgia rheumatica also suffer from temporal arthritis, so we have given explanations to get more familiar with this disease. 1 out of every 5 people with polymyalgia rheumatica will develop a more serious disease called temporal arthritis, in which the arteries of the head and neck become inflamed. Symptoms of temporal arthritis are: - Sudden and severe headache (scalp pain and sensitivity) - Jaw muscle pain when eating - creating vision problems such as diplopia or reduced vision If you have any of these symptoms, see your doctor right away for treatment... Unlike polymyalgia rheumatica, temporal arthritis requires immediate medical attention. Because if the treatment is not done on time, it will lead to permanent loss of vision.
